Development Manager

Reports to:

Executive Director Key partner:
Events and Cultural Officer, on fundraising events

Compensation:
Salary range $80,000-$95,000, commensurate with experience. Benefits include 10 vacation days, 15 annual holidays, 6 sick days, 4 personal days, employer contribution toward health, dental, and vision insurance, and a 401(k) option.

Time commitment:
Monday thru Friday, 9am to 5pm, with occasional evenings and weekends to support events and networking opportunities. This is a primarily in-person, on-site role, reflecting the community and relationship driven nature of the work.

Location:

Yonkers, NY / Westchester County, NY

Position Overview

Since 1996, Aisling Irish Community & Cultural Center has been a home base for the Irish and Irish-American community in Yonkers and Woodlawn supporting new immigrants, connecting generations through cultural programming, and serving seniors and youth alike. The Development Manager will play a central role in keeping that mission funded and growing, overseeing and driving all fundraising activities for the organization.

This role manages and grows a diverse portfolio of funders, donors, and fundraising initiatives, and is responsible for building new revenue pipelines in line with organizational goals.

The ideal candidate is a skilled, experienced fundraising professional whose values align with Aisling's mission, with strong communication and organizational skills, and a proven track record of both expanding fundraising pipelines and stewarding long-term donor relationships. This is an opportunity to make a meaningful, visible impact at a growing organization, with room for professional growth as Aisling expands.

This job description provides a general overview of the role. Specific duties and responsibilities may evolve over time.

Strategy & Goal Setting
  • Partner with the Executive Director to set annual fundraising objectives, establish clear metrics and targets, and design and execute strategic development plans to achieve revenue goals.
  • Identify and develop new fundraising pipelines and revenue streams to diversify and grow the organization's funding base.
Grants Management
  • Identify and evaluate new grant opportunities; oversee the full grant cycle including timely submission of proposals, program budgets, and impact reports.
  • Monitor active grant cycles, track deliverables, and ensure full compliance with grant and funder requirements, including those from NY State and local agencies, private foundations, corporate funders, and Ireland's Emigrant Support Programme (ESP).
Donor & Campaign Management
  • Manage the growth and success of the annual Aisling Fund Campaign.
  • Drive donor acquisition and outreach: cultivate relationships with new and existing donors, promote networking initiatives, and expand the organization's donor base.
  • Oversee management of the donor database (Bloomerang) and maintain accurate fundraising statistics and reporting.
  • Ensure funders and donors are accurately and consistently acknowledged and recognized across event materials, program communications, and organizational publications, coordinating with the Events and Cultural Officer and program staff as needed.
Events
  • Set strategic direction and fundraising goals for events, partnering with the Events and Cultural Officer on day-to-day event execution.
Qualifications
Required
  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ent professional experience, and 3+ years of relevant fundraising or development experience in a full-time staff role.
  • Demonstrated experience with media relations and donor cultivation.
  • Demonstrated experience with state and local grant agencies and platforms.
  • Demonstrated experience with private foundation and/or corporate grant funding.
  • Demonstrated experience working with fundraising software, project management tools, and CRMs.
  • Demonstrated experience developing new fundraising pipelines and strategies, as well as managing and growing existing donor portfolios.
  • Strong management and problem-solving skills, with a demonstrated ability to take initiative, collaborate effectively across teams, and drive projects forward independently.
Preferred
  • Experience raising funds, managing budgets, and building donor relationships for a small grassroots or community-based social service organization with an annual operating budget ofat least $1 million.
  • Experience with Ireland's Emigrant Support Programme (ESP) or similar international/government-to-diaspora grant funding.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, Bloomerang or a similar CRM, and the New York Statewide Financial System (SFS).
  • Comfort using AI tools for first drafts of donor communications, content, or prospect research.
  • Experience with or understanding of Irish culture, and an interest in supporting the Irish diaspora in the Yonkers/Woodlawn area of New York.
